(LifeSiteNews) — On July 17, Polish President Karol Nawrocki vetoed two bills that would have opened the door to same-sex “marriage” by introducing “cohabitation contracts” for couples who live together.

Prime Minister Donald Tusk, who has headed Poland’s coalition government since 2023, responded furiously, stating: “The presidential veto is an expression of contempt for people and their right to happiness and a normal life.”

Nawrocki’s victory in the presidential election last June was an electoral rebuke to Tusk, and abortion activists saw the Law and Justice candidate’s win as a “devastating blow” to their agenda. Nawrocki’s presidential veto now serves as a safety valve on Tusk’s top-down social revolution. His July 17 veto on a bill on the “status of the closest person in a relationship and the cohabitation agreement” is a prime example.

Tusk had worked hard to get the bill passed; it was a compromise with conservative lawmakers who thought previous iterations undermined the institution of marriage. Poland’s constitution explicitly protects marriage in Article 18: “Marriage, being a union of a man and a woman, as well as the family, motherhood and parenthood, shall be placed under the protection and care of the Republic of Poland.”

“These proposals create a new, formalized institution of family law, equipped with a broad catalogue of rights similar to those of marriage,” Nawrocki stated in a recorded explanation of his veto. “As the guardian of the Constitution, I cannot accept a solution that would lead to the loss of the special status of marriage, defined in Article 18 of the Constitution as a union of a man and a woman under the protection and care of the Republic of Poland.”

The bill is now effectively dead, as Tusk would need a three-fifths majority to overrule the veto and he faces opposition from conservative lawmakers. Miko Czerwinski, director of Campaign Against Homophobia, responded angrily to the decision, stating: “Once again, the voice of society has proven irrelevant to those in power. We are not willing to accept this. We will continue working towards full marriage equality.”
